**Ticket: Expired creds blocking Quillstone schema registry**

The Quillstone event schema registry rejected all publishes at 03:12 — the CI service credential lapsed. Orchard pipeline is red; the Dovetail release cut is blocked until this clears. Rotation was done on the registry side but the consumers were never updated. Deploy freeze stays on until validation passes. For the interim, the build runner should use the freshly issued key below.

gateway credential: kto23_LX9A4ys6i4nzHtpOLNLodKK

# Query planner regression (Fernwald v4.2). Plans for the orders
# join flipped to sequential scans after the stats refresh. Mitigation:
# forced index hints enabled below; remove once v4.3 lands. Do not
# re-run ANALYZE on the hot tables until then. Reproduce against the
# replica using the connection string below.

primary connection of yagep-kahip = redis://giliel_svc:zYiKsLL2PLpfPL@db-348f.xolmarsys.corp:5432/fenwyn

Hey plugin folks! Every Fernwick deployment ships with the `tallyhop` sidecar, which scrapes your plugin's metrics endpoint every 15 seconds and rolls them up before forwarding. Your job is simple: expose counters in the standard flat format and `tallyhop` does the rest. Naming conventions matter, though — bad prefixes get dropped silently. The full conventions guide and sample configs are on the internal page.

dashboard of bahaf-tageg = https://jira.zemvarlabs.internal/projects/projects/browse/projects

Present: full management committee. Prepared for the board.

Agenda: transfer of tier-one customer support to Calverno Services.

Decided: twelve-month contract, pilot in the Rastbury queue first. Headcount impact handled via redeployment; no layoffs in phase one. Service-level penalties agreed at draft terms. Quorix, our current vendor, to be wound down by quarter-end. Risk register updated; legal sign-off expected Friday. Next review in four weeks. A confidential addendum for board members follows.

board note of bawep-tajef: Queniusek Systems plans to raise the Quenvan list price by 53.1 percent in March. The pricing group signed off on a budget of $176.4 million for Project Drueth. The renewal with Casionix Partners closes at $142.5 million a year, 8.3 percent below the last contract. Project Fraax slips by six weeks because of the tooling delay.